Abstract
The research has been carried out to improve technologies and equipment for drilling multilateral wells constructions to create the most feasible well spacing. To prove the idea testing technical features of shaped tube ability to take its initial shape due to the action of inner and outer liquid pressure the investigation has been carried out. The tests have shown the capability of cramp iron to be reused for fastening whipstock inside the well with its following extracting.
